Strategies for building scalable computer vision pipelines that handle massive image and video datasets efficiently.
Effective, future-proof pipelines for computer vision require scalable architecture, intelligent data handling, and robust processing strategies to manage ever-growing image and video datasets with speed and precision.
Published July 18, 2025
Facebook X Reddit Pinterest Email
In the modern era of AI, scalable computer vision pipelines are not a luxury but a necessity. Teams must design end-to-end systems that can ingest, transform, train, and evaluate at scale while maintaining reliability and reproducibility. The foundation begins with clear data contracts and versioning, ensuring that datasets, labels, and model artifacts remain consistent across experiments. Storage choices should balance cost and access speed, with tiered architecture that moves archival material to slower media while keeping active workloads responsive. Monitoring and incident response become built-in features, not afterthoughts. By prioritizing modularity and clear interfaces, engineers lay groundwork for growth without compromising stability.
A scalable pipeline requires a thoughtful combination of data engineering, machine learning, and operations practices. At the data layer, adopt a robust metadata system that tracks provenance, transformations, and lineage. This enables reproducibility and simplifies debugging when anomalies appear. Compute layers should leverage parallel processing, distributed training, and efficient data sharding to minimize idle time and maximize throughput. Observability extends beyond metrics to include traces and logs that reveal bottlenecks at every stage. Finally, deployment pipelines must support continuous integration and testing, with guards that prevent regressions in data quality or model performance as new images and videos flow through the system.
Build robust pipelines with modular, observable, and compliant components.
The data contracts defined at the outset determine how data evolves across stages. Contracts specify accepted formats, labeling schemas, and quality thresholds, establishing a common expectation among data engineers, researchers, and operators. In practice, this means standardizing image resolutions, color spaces, and annotation conventions, while preserving the flexibility to accommodate edge cases. Versioned datasets enable rollbacks if introduced transformations introduce drift. Provenance records document who, when, and why a change occurred, which is invaluable during audits or post hoc analyses. By embracing strict but practical contracts, teams reduce surprises and accelerate collaborative workflows, ensuring that downstream components can rely on stable inputs.
ADVERTISEMENT
ADVERTISEMENT
Provenance also supports accountability in model iteration cycles. When new data arrives, the system should automatically tag which datasets contributed to an experiment and how those contributions influenced results. This transparency helps identify bias, distribution shifts, or mislabeled samples that might skew performance. Additionally, reproducible pipelines support audits for compliance in regulated industries where traceability matters. The combination of contracts and provenance fosters trust among stakeholders and speeds up decision-making. As teams scale, these controls prevent small misalignments from cascading into costly retraining and degraded accuracy.
Choose processing frameworks that maximize efficiency and resilience.
As datasets balloon in size, data engineering becomes the backbone of a scalable CV system. Efficient storage layouts, such as chunked formats and compact encodings, reduce I/O pressure and lower costs. Data transforms should be carefully staged, with lazy evaluation where possible to avoid unnecessary computation. Caching frequently used preprocessed data dramatically accelerates iterative experiments. A well-designed data catalog provides discoverability and lineage across teams, enabling researchers to locate relevant datasets quickly. Security and privacy considerations must be woven into every layer, including access controls and anonymization when dealing with sensitive media. When data flows are clean, researchers can focus on model improvements rather than data wrangling.
ADVERTISEMENT
ADVERTISEMENT
Designing for scalability also means choosing the right processing framework. For CPU-bound tasks, vectorized operations and batched inference provide meaningful speedups. For GPU-accelerated workloads, adapters and data loaders should maximize GPU occupancy, minimize host-device transfer, and avoid branching that stalls pipelines. Streaming or micro-batching can keep models responsive while maintaining throughput. In distributed environments, orchestration tools coordinate resource usage, fault tolerance, and scaling policies. A well-chosen framework reduces complexity and ensures that future hardware upgrades or cloud migrations remain straightforward rather than disruptive.
Design scalable inference with robust serving, testing, and drift monitoring.
Model development activities demand scalable compute strategies as well. Distributed training enables handling larger models and datasets by splitting workloads across many devices. Techniques such as gradient accumulation, mixed precision, and adaptive learning rates help achieve convergence with fewer cycles, saving time and resources. Hyperparameter sweeps must be managed intelligently, leveraging early stopping and parallel search strategies to avoid wasting compute. When training is expensive, checkpoints become vital, allowing progress to be resumed after interruptions rather than starting over. Ultimately, scalable pipelines empower teams to explore more ideas without being constrained by infrastructure limits.
Inference at scale presents its own challenges that require careful design. Serving architectures should support concurrent requests, model versioning, and A/B testing without sacrificing latency. Edge inference might be necessary for latency-sensitive applications, but central servers often provide stronger resource utilization and easier monitoring. Quality assurance processes, including automated validation against holdout sets and drift detection, safeguard model reliability as data distributions change. Observability should cover response times, error rates, and confidence scores, enabling rapid diagnosis when real-world data diverges from training conditions.
ADVERTISEMENT
ADVERTISEMENT
Implement disciplined deployment, monitoring, and drift defense.
Video processing introduces unique demands, such as temporal consistency and higher data rates. Pipelines must handle frame rates, codecs, and variable scene complexity while maintaining stable throughput. Frame sampling strategies reduce redundant work without sacrificing essential information for detection or tracking tasks. Data augmentation should be carefully chosen to preserve temporal coherence across frames. With large video collections, system architects implement tiered processing—lightweight analyzes on raw streams and deeper, offline passes for richer features. By aligning hardware, software, and data policies, teams ensure that video workloads remain responsive as volumes grow.
Another critical consideration is model deployment discipline. Feature flags facilitate progressive rollouts, while shadow deployments let teams compare new and baseline models side by side under real traffic. Observability dashboards should highlight drift indicators and accuracy metrics in production, not just offline performance. Incident response playbooks guide operators through remediation steps when data quality or latency deteriorates. Automated retraining triggers based on predefined thresholds help keep models current. A disciplined deployment lifecycle reduces risk and accelerates the path from research to real-world impact.
Resource management must account for both cost and performance. Autoscaling policies adjust compute capacity in response to workload fluctuations, preventing overprovisioning while preserving responsiveness. Cost-aware scheduling prioritizes efficient use of expensive accelerators and minimizes idle time between tasks. Data movement costs, especially across cloud regions, deserve careful planning. Intelligent placement strategies can place heavy processing closer to where data resides, thereby reducing latency. Monitoring should quantify not only errors but also resource utilization patterns, enabling proactive optimization. As pipelines scale, financial awareness becomes a strategic advantage, helping teams justify investments with measurable ROI.
Finally, culture and governance underpin scalable success. Cross-functional collaboration between data engineers, researchers, and operators fosters shared ownership and faster iteration cycles. Clear documentation, naming conventions, and onboarding workflows reduce knowledge gaps as teams grow. Governance practices, including security reviews and ethical considerations for data use, build trust with users and regulators alike. Continuous learning loops—postmortems, blameless retrospectives, and knowledge sharing—drive gradual improvement. When technical decisions align with organizational goals, scalable computer vision pipelines deliver consistent value across diverse projects and evolving data landscapes.
Related Articles
Computer vision
Effective cross sensor calibration and synchronization are essential to fuse diverse visual inputs, enabling robust perception, accurate localization, and resilient scene understanding across platforms and environments.
-
August 08, 2025
Computer vision
Deploying real time video analytics on constrained edge devices demands thoughtful design choices, efficient models, compact data pipelines, and rigorous testing to achieve high accuracy, low latency, and robust reliability in dynamic environments.
-
July 18, 2025
Computer vision
Researchers and engineers can build end-to-end data pipelines that automatically blur faces, occlude identifying features, and redact metadata in images and videos, then test utility metrics to ensure downstream machine learning models remain effective for research while protecting privacy.
-
July 18, 2025
Computer vision
A practical, evergreen guide to designing vision systems that maintain safety and usefulness when certainty falters, including robust confidence signaling, fallback strategies, and continuous improvement pathways for real-world deployments.
-
July 16, 2025
Computer vision
In the field of computer vision, robust detection of adversarial patches and physical world attacks requires layered defense, careful evaluation, and practical deployment strategies that adapt to evolving threat models and sensor modalities.
-
August 07, 2025
Computer vision
A comprehensive guide explores how context aware filtering and ensemble decisions reduce false alarms in vision surveillance, balancing sensitivity with reliability by integrating scene understanding, temporal consistency, and multi-model collaboration.
-
July 30, 2025
Computer vision
This evergreen exploration surveys practical few-shot learning strategies for visual classification, highlighting data efficiency, model adaptation, and robust performance when encountering unseen categories with limited labeled examples.
-
July 18, 2025
Computer vision
This evergreen guide outlines practical benchmarks, data practices, and evaluation methodologies to uncover biases, quantify equity, and implement principled changes that minimize disparate impact in computer vision deployments.
-
July 18, 2025
Computer vision
This article outlines robust methods for choosing suitable datasets and tasks to evaluate commercial vision APIs, emphasizing relevance, bias mitigation, reproducibility, and business impact for sustained product quality.
-
August 07, 2025
Computer vision
Designing robust video action recognition with limited data relies on reusing spatiotemporal features, strategic distillation, and efficiency-focused architectures that transfer rich representations across tasks while preserving accuracy and speed.
-
July 19, 2025
Computer vision
This evergreen guide explores deliberate cross domain testing, revealing subtle failures, biases, and context shifts that standard benchmarks overlook, and provides practical methods to improve robustness across diverse data landscapes.
-
July 26, 2025
Computer vision
Generating photorealistic training imagery through advanced generative models enables specialized vision systems to learn robustly. This article explores practical strategies, model choices, and evaluation approaches that help practitioners craft diverse, high-fidelity datasets that better reflect real-world variability and domain-specific nuances. We examine photorealism, controllable generation, data distribution considerations, safety and bias mitigations, and workflow integration to accelerate research and deployment in fields requiring precise visual understanding.
-
July 30, 2025
Computer vision
This evergreen guide examines image based biometric systems, detailing security, privacy protections, and fraud detection safeguards, with practical implementation tips, risk awareness, regulatory considerations, and resilient design choices.
-
July 18, 2025
Computer vision
This evergreen guide explores how modern anomaly detection in images blends representation learning with reconstruction strategies to identify unusual patterns, leveraging unsupervised insights, robust modeling, and practical deployment considerations across diverse visual domains.
-
August 06, 2025
Computer vision
This evergreen analysis examines interpretability methods for visual recognition in high-stakes settings, emphasizing transparency, accountability, user trust, and robust evaluation across diverse real-world scenarios to guide responsible deployment.
-
August 12, 2025
Computer vision
This article explores practical, localized explanation techniques for vision model choices, emphasizing domain expert insights, interpretability, and robust collaboration across specialized fields to validate models effectively.
-
July 24, 2025
Computer vision
Adaptive normalization techniques offer a resilient approach to visual data, unifying color stability and sensor variability, thereby enhancing machine perception across diverse environments and imaging conditions without sacrificing performance.
-
August 09, 2025
Computer vision
Benchmarking AI systems now demands more than raw accuracy; this article outlines practical, repeatable methods to measure interpretability, resilience, and equitable outcomes alongside predictive performance, guiding teams toward holistic evaluation.
-
July 25, 2025
Computer vision
In real-world operations, metrics must reflect practical impact, not just accuracy, by incorporating cost, reliability, latency, context, and user experience to ensure sustained performance and value realization.
-
July 19, 2025
Computer vision
This evergreen article explains how synthetic ray traced imagery can illuminate material properties and reflectance behavior for computer vision models, offering robust strategies, validation methods, and practical guidelines for researchers and practitioners alike.
-
July 24, 2025